你查询的IP:[122.98.128.103]  地理位置:印度

最新查询202.93.11.242 58.30.133.32 220.112.79.80 210.21.0.15 166.111.17.124 203.90.128.143 114.60.20.89 118.64.201.11 122.198.231.247 122.98.128.103 203.100.96.107 202.122.64.94 124.88.253.43 123.49.128.69 123.249.179.250 221.199.224.194 117.122.128.224 202.93.247.142 121.60.64.54 125.215.101.205 119.128.7.38 124.192.181.50 211.160.42.228 119.30.48.59 123.96.242.51 116.112.195.105 123.103.9.136 119.18.208.48 124.248.209.150 60.194.138.176 222.32.2.220